Insight Editions and actor, Kevin Costner, have announced the official tie-in book to his films, “Horizon: An American Saga Chapters One and Two.” Exploring the films’ characters and locations, “The Great Horizon: Photographing Kevin Costner’s American Saga” (through publisher Weldon Owen), tells the story of the saga’s creation through intimate cast portraits and behind-the-scenes photography by Cale Glendening. 

“Horizon: An American Saga” is Costner’s look at the settling of the West, exploring the lure of the frontier and how it was won – and lost – through the blood, sweat and tears of many. Channeling classic Western photography with images in both black-and-white and color, Glendening offers a deeper look into each of the characters of “Horizon.” Shooting each member of the cast between takes on set, these portraits give readers an intimate glimpse into what it takes to inhabit such a harsh Western landscape.

The volume features photographs of the cast in an emotionally raw state between takes and beautiful location photography shot across Utah, including never-before-seen portraits of Costner and actors, Sienna Miller, Luke Wilson, Abbey Lee, Sam Worthington, Isabelle Fuhrmann, Tatanka Means, Jamie Campbell Bower, Jena Malone, Michael Rooker, Danny Houston, Owen Crow Shoe, Giovanni Ribisi, Tom Payne, Will Patton and Ella Hunt.

“The Great Horizon: Photographing Kevin Costner’s American Saga” is available for preorder and will be available in November wherever books are sold.
